您的位置:

VueTools全面解析与应用

作为Vue.js框架的完整且独立的工具集,VueTools提供了一系列强大的功能和工具,使得我们可以更加方便快捷地开发和维护Vue.js应用程序。本文将对VueTools进行全面解析,从使用入门到高级应用,为您呈现VueTools的魅力和实用价值。

一、快速调试工具

VueTools提供了一个强大的调试工具,在使用Vue.js时可以帮助我们更加方便地检查组件的状态、属性和UI效果,并且可以在实时模式下进行完善的调试操作。

我们可以在Vue.js开发过程中使用调试工具,打开浏览器的控制台,在调试窗口上方启用Vue.js追踪器,以便在控制台中观察组件树、组件数据和事件。另外,调试工具还可以监测到应用程序的整个生命周期,方便我们快速定位问题所在。

下面是一个简单的示例程序,演示了如何使用VueTools进行调试:

<template>
  <div>
    <my-component :message="msg"></my-component>
  </div>
</template>

<script>
  export default {
    data() {
      return {
        msg: 'Hello World!'
      }
    }
  }
</script>

二、模板指令与组件库

VueTools还提供了丰富的模板指令和多款待用的组件库,帮助我们更加轻松地构建复杂的Web应用程序。其中,模板指令可以帮助我们更加方便地处理DOM元素的交互,而组件库则提供了通用的UI组件和模板的各种示例,可以帮助我们快速构建Web应用程序。

为了使用VueTools提供的模板指令和组件库,首先我们需要引入Vue.js和VueTools,并将其注入到Vue.js应用程序中。然后,在Vue.js的模板中使用指令和组件即可。

下面是一个简单的示例程序,演示了如何使用VueTools提供的模板指令:

<template>
  <div v-if="isVisible">
    <p v-html="message"></p>
    <button v-on:click="handleClick">Click Me</button>
  </div>
</template>

<script>
  import { defineComponent } from 'vue'
  export default defineComponent({
    data() {
      return {
        isVisible: true,
        message: 'Hello World!'
      }
    },
    methods: {
      handleClick() {
        this.isVisible = !this.isVisible
      }
    }
  })
</script>

三、构建工具与生态系统

除了提供快速调试工具和丰富的模板指令和组件库之外,VueTools还提供了一个完整的构建工具和生态系统,帮助我们更加方便地构建、测试和维护Vue.js应用程序。

VueTools提供了Vue CLI,一个完整的脚手架工具,可以创建Vue.js应用程序的初始结构、配置文件和依赖项,并且可以使用插件和打包工具自定义Vue.js应用程序的构建流程。另外,VueTools还提供了Vue.js社区中丰富的插件和库,可以帮助我们快速解决各种常见的问题。

下面是一个简单的示例程序,演示了如何使用Vue CLI构建Vue.js应用程序:

$ npm install -g @vue/cli
$ vue create my-app
$ cd my-app
$ npm run serve

四、总结

在本文中,我们全面解析了VueTools的功能、特点和应用价值。通过对VueTools的深入理解和应用,我们可以更加方便快捷地开发和维护Vue.js应用程序,提高Web开发的效率和质量。如果您还没有开始使用VueTools,请不要错过这个强大而又实用的工具集。